What is Product Schema Markup?

Product Schema Markup is a type of structured data defined by Schema.org that provides detailed information about a product. When added to your website, it helps search engines display rich snippets, such as star ratings, price, availability, and reviews, directly in search results.

How to Implement Product Schema Markup

Implementing Product Schema Markup involves adding specific JSON-LD code to your product pages. Many SEO plugins and tools can assist with this, or you can add the code manually.

Example of Product Schema JSON-LD

Here is a simple example:

{
  "@context": "https://schema.org/",
  "@type": "Product",
  "name": "Wireless Bluetooth Headphones",
  "image": "https://example.com/images/headphones.jpg",
  "description": "High-quality wireless headphones with noise cancellation.",
  "sku": "12345",
  "brand": {
    "@type": "Brand",
    "name": "AudioTech"
  },
  "offers": {
    "@type": "Offer",
    "priceCurrency": "USD",
    "price": "99.99",
    "itemCondition": "https://schema.org/NewCondition",
    "availability": "https://schema.org/InStock",
    "url": "https://example.com/products/headphones"
  },
  "aggregateRating": {
    "@type": "AggregateRating",
    "ratingValue": "4.5",
    "reviewCount": "24"
  }
}

Best Practices for Using Product Schema Markup

  • Ensure all product information is accurate and up-to-date.
  • Include high-quality images and detailed descriptions.
  • Use reviews and ratings to build trust.
  • Test your markup with Google’s Rich Results Test tool.
  • Keep your structured data consistent with your website content.
